About

Bujar’s deep expertise and vast experience in applied structural dynamics are invaluable to clients who face tough wind engineering and structural response challenges. Through three decades of professional experience, research, and consulting, he has earned a reputation for delivering outstanding results in the structural optimization of tall buildings and other dynamically sensitive structures. In addition to managing highly complex and very demanding projects around the globe, Bujar leads quality assurance and technical development for our structural, wind engineering, and damping system implementation consulting services.
